Add Devices in Batch
Steps:
1. Click Add to open the device adding dialog.
2. Select Hik-Connect Domain as the adding mode.
3. Select Batch Adding.
4. Input the required information.
Hik-Connect Account: Input the Hik-Connect account.
Hik-Connect Password: Input the Hik-Connect password.
5. Click Get Device List to show the devices added to Hik-Connect account.
